Overview
PDTB114EUX from Nexperia is a 500 mA, 50 V PNP resistor-equipped transistor (RET) in SOT323 (SC-70) package, featuring integrated 10 kΩ input bias resistor (R1) and 10 kΩ base-emitter resistor (R2) with ±10% ratio tolerance. It delivers −100 mV VCE(sat) at −50 mA/−2.5 mA drive, supports −50 V VCEO, and operates up to 175 °C ambient - used for high-reliability digital switching in automotive body control modules.

Technical Context
This PNP RET integrates two precision thin-film resistors (R1 = 10 kΩ, R2 = 10 kΩ) directly on-die to form a monolithic bias network, eliminating external components while maintaining 0.9–1.1 R2/R1 ratio tolerance. Its −50 V VCEO and −500 mA IO rating support robust load switching in 12 V/24 V automotive subsystems.
The device achieves 70 minimum hFE at −50 mA/−5 V, −100 mV VCE(sat) under standard drive, and 140 MHz fT - enabling fast digital switching with low power loss. Built-in ESD protection and AEC-Q101 qualification confirm suitability for under-hood applications requiring operation from −55 °C to +175 °C.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| VCEO | −50 V: Maximum collector-emitter voltage before breakdown; enables use in 24 V automotive systems with margin. |
| IO | −500 mA: Continuous output current capability; supports driving medium-power relays or LEDs directly. |
| R1 / R2 | 10 kΩ / 10 kΩ: Integrated bias resistors eliminate two external components and reduce PCB footprint. |
| VCE(sat) | −100 mV @ −50 mA/−2.5 mA: Low saturation voltage minimizes conduction loss and self-heating in switching mode. |
| hFE | 70 min @ −50 mA/−5 V: Sufficient DC gain for reliable digital on/off control without additional amplification. |
| fT | 140 MHz: Transition frequency confirms suitability for >1 MHz digital signal switching with minimal delay. |
| Tj(max) | 175 °C: Maximum junction temperature allows operation in high-temperature engine bay environments. |

FAQ
What is the maximum allowable input voltage (VI) for PDTB114EUX?
The absolute maximum input voltage is −50 V (VI) and +10 V, per Table 6. This wide range accommodates transient overvoltage events in automotive 12 V systems, including load dump spikes. Operation within −1.5 V to −3.0 V ensures reliable turn-on, while staying above −0.6 V prevents unintended activation.
How does PDTB114EUX handle thermal stress in enclosed enclosures?
With Rth(j-a) = 353 K/W on 4-layer FR4 PCB (Table 7), PDTB114EUX dissipates up to 425 mW at 25 °C ambient. At 100 °C ambient, derated power drops to ~250 mW. Its 175 °C Tj(max) and −55 °C to +175 °C Tamb rating allow full functionality in sealed, non-ventilated housings typical in automotive junction boxes.
Can PDTB114EUX replace BC807-40 in existing designs without layout changes?
No - PDTB114EUX uses SOT323 (SC-70), while BC807-40 uses SOT23. The SOT323 footprint is smaller (1.35 × 1.15 mm vs. 2.9 × 1.3 mm) and has different lead pitch (0.65 mm vs. 0.95 mm). A PCB redesign is required; however, the integrated resistors eliminate two 0402/0603 passives, offsetting layout effort with BOM simplification.
Is the R2/R1 ratio guaranteed across temperature and voltage?
Yes - the R2/R1 ratio is specified as 0.9 to 1.1 (±10%) over full operating conditions (Table 8), measured at Tamb = 25 °C. Characterization data (Figs 46–49) confirms stable VI(on)/VI(off) behavior from −40 °C to +100 °C, ensuring consistent switching thresholds in thermal cycling environments.
